What to Watch For

Watch for:

  • Confusion or if the child is easily distracted and cannot do normal activities
  • Stares blankly
  • Delayed answering of questions
  • Slurred speech
  • Stumbling or clumsiness, uncoordinated or cannot walk a straight line
  • Cries very easily or becomes angry easily or exhibits extreme emotions
  • Problem with memory, repeats self, repeatedly asks questions, unable to recall words or objects
  • Loss of consciousness

Other symptoms of a concussion:

  • Confusion
  • Loss of memory about accident
  • Headache
  • Nausea
  • Difficulty with memory
  • Slowed thinking
  • Tiredness
  • Change in sleep
  • Unbalanced
  • Dizziness
  • Ringing in ears
  • Increased sensitivity to light or sounds
  • Mood changes — sad, irritable, non-motivated
  • Blurred vision
  • Ringing in ears
